A Case of Ticagrelor Rescue Therapy in a Patient with Subacute Stent Thrombosis / 대한내과학회지
Korean Journal of Medicine ; : 598-602, 2014.
Article in Korean | WPRIM | ID: wpr-140476
ABSTRACT
Stent thrombosis (ST) is a rare but catastrophic complication of a drug-eluting stent. Although dual antiplatelet therapy with aspirin and clopidogrel significantly reduces the occurrence of ST, it continues to occur and is occasionally associated with clopidogrel resistance. Here, we describe a 71-yr-old man with subacute stent thrombosis and clopidogrel resistance following drug-eluting stent implantation who underwent successful ticagrelor rescue therapy.
